Police say a motorist will be appearing in court after failing a breath test - and turning out to have no driving licence.
Officers from the Roads Policing Unit stopped a white van on Derby Square in Douglas yesterday evening.
The driver failed a roadside breath test and was arrested.
Police the message is simple - don't drink or drug drive.
